Nashville expands COVID-19 vaccination eligibility to everyone 16+

covid19.nashville.gov

NASHVILLE, Tenn. (Mike Osborne)  --  Every Nashville resident 16 and older is now eligible to receive a COVID-19 vaccination.

Metro residents can make an appointment to be immunized at COVID19.nashville.gov, or by calling the city’s pandemic hotline at 615-862-7777.

State health officials report that roughly 28 percent of Nashvillians have received at least one injection. Just under 12 percent are now fully immunized.

Nashville has reported well over 94,000 cases of COVID-19 since the pandemic began. A total of 871 Metro residents have died due to virus complications. There are currently just over 1,800 active cases citywide.
